RIVERA, José Luis Manzanares. Suicide mortality phenomenon in México: territorial patterns based on 20 years of information. Estudios Socioterritoriales [online]. 2020, vol.28, pp.59-59. ISSN 1853-4392.  http://dx.doi.org/10.37838/unicen/est.28-059.

The purpose is to document Mexico´s temporary suicide evolution during the period 1998-2017 with a focus on Aguascalientes State. The methodology is based on exploratory data analysis using public mortality records collected by the national system for health information for two different data structures, cross section and time series. Results indicate that the States of Chihuahua and Aguascalientes are the ones with the highest mortality currently. A temporal pattern of higher monthly incidence was documented for May and June in the 20-year period studied. For its part, the analysis at the metropolitan area scale, allows to identify the Aguascalientes Metropolitan area as the one with the highest concentration, specifically affecting the population between 12 and 32 years of age.
